About this restaurant

Osteria delle Pietre feels like the sort of place that makes a village detour worthwhile: stone walls, a small piazza, lively tables, and the hum of a busy local room. Diners describe it as bustling and warm, with the most memorable first impression often being the setting itself—"Italian flair on a little piazza"—though the charm comes with uneven ground, tight walkways, and chairs that not everyone finds comfortable. The kitchen is traditional rather than experimental, built around inexpensive pizzas, farinata, focaccia, local cheeses and cured meats, plus grilled meat cooked on the testi. Pizza is the clear crowd-pleaser, with several repeat visitors calling it outstanding; the mixed farinata also earns unusually strong praise. Meat can be excellent, but timing and doneness are less dependable, and service ranges from genuinely helpful to slow or brusque. At roughly €20-30 for a typical meal before drinks, the pricing is easy to justify—provided you book and keep an eye on the bill. Families should find recognizable choices: Margherita, Prosciutto Cotto, Marinara, simple focaccia, potatoes, salad, and grilled vegetables give children and cautious eaters workable options. The menu is not exclusively adventurous, and reviews mention welcoming visits with children, but the reservation-first policy, uneven surfaces, crowded layout, and occasional delays may test younger diners. Book ahead rather than relying on a spontaneous family walk-in.
